Zevgolateio (, also Ζευγολατιό - Zevgolatio) is a town in the municipality Velo-Vocha, Corinthia, Greece. It is located 82 kilometers west of Athens. In 2021, the town had a population of 4,269. It is the seat of the municipality Velo-Vocha. The Zevgolatio railway station is served by trains between Athens and Kiato.
